I use both exchange and I am in Bittrex now. The first exchange that I use is Poloniex because it has the highest trading volume before but due to some reports and FUD spreading about them being shut down and withdrawal issues then I decided to transfer to Bittrex because I can see that many people are transferring there and it has variety of choices of coins as well compared to Poloniex. Recently, there is this problem of Bittrex as well deactivating accounts even though it is already enhanced and for those who has basic accounts are required to enhance their accounts but I am not affected by this but I am having doubts now of whether I would choose Bittrex still. Binance would be an alternative for me and Gexcrypto too when it is already launched. I hope that those affected accounts would be activated and problems be solved.

Bittrex has temporarily closed registration to new users, unfortunately making Poloniex the only option to sign up between these two exchanges at the moment. As others have mentioned, Binance is an other exchange to consider for similar services.

Bittrex vs Poloniex vs Binance Key Points of Comparison
  • Customer Support: While none of these exchanges have anywhere close to perfect customer support, Poloniex seems to be particularly bad in this area. Many Poloniex users have experiences support tickets taking multiple months. Binance and Bittrex support is usually handled in a more reasonable time frame of a few weeks max.
  • Verification Requirements: Binance by default allows you to withdrawal the equivalent of 2 BTC / day, without requiring any personal information. You can increase this to 100 BTC / day by completing verification. Both Bittrex and Poloniex require verification for any withdrawals. Keep in mind Poloniex's poor customer support may severely delay your verification.
  • Current Trading Pairs: Binance 264, Bittrex 261, Poloniex 99. Not only does Binance currently have the most trading pairs, but they've also been most consistent recently in adding news coins to their exchange.
  • Trading Fees: Binance 0.1%, Bittrex 0.25%, Poloniex 0.25% or less (maker-taker fee schedule)
